Overview

Thierry Besson is affiliated with the University of Rouen in France. Their research primarily focuses on the field of chemistry, with a particular emphasis on organic chemistry. Research topics explored by Besson include quinazolinone synthesis and applications, catalytic C-H functionalization methods, acute lymphoblastic leukemia research, synthesis and biological evaluation, as well as the synthesis and characterization of heterocyclic compounds.

The scientist's work in acute lymphoblastic leukemia reflects an engagement with biomedical research, in addition to fundamental chemical synthesis studies. Their publication topics frequently combine synthesis and biological activity, catalytic reactions, and the evaluation of therapeutic potential in heterocyclic compound development.
